Archival history
The volume bears the names of Isma(e)l Jones / Dafydd, Bryn Byll. The booklets subsequently passed into the library of W. J. Roberts ('Gwilym Cowlyd').

Scope and content
A composite volume comprising: (I) Four booklets in the hand of David Jones ('Dewi Fardd', 1708?-85), Trefriw containing an incomplete text of his '[Cronicl] Hanes [Cymru] a'i Thrig[olion] er amser Julius Caesa[r] hyd amser neu Deyrna[siad] y Brenhin Iago y Cyntaf'; a 'cywydd' by Tho. Prys; an incomplete list of titles (pp. 484-526) in David Jones : Blodeu-gerdd Cymry (Y Mwythig, 1759); and carols, etc., among them 'Newyddion Gyng'aneddau' by David Jones. (Ii) A booklet largely in the hand of Evan Thomas (ob. 1781), Cwmhwylfod, Sarnau, near Bala containing extracts from Y Drych Cristianogawl (Rhotomagi, 1585); and poetry in strict and free metres by Evan James, Sr. Rogier, Edward Sam[ue]l, Dafydd yn Ifan ('o Lanfair Careinion'), Edwart Moris, John Edward Ma..., Hugh Hughes and John William(s); and anonymous compositions, among them a 'Hymn yngulch duwdod Iesu Grist ...'. The spine is lettered 'Mân Lyfrau Dewi Fardd ac eraill'.
